Joshua Tree National Park is a seemingly boundless playground for rock climbers and adventurers of all types. Every year (except this year unfortunately) I meet up with a tight knit group of climbers that descend upon Joshua Tree National Park, specifically in Ryan Campground for what has been coined #JtreeTweetup. This little gathering started a few years ago through the power of Twitter, and an eager group of climbers who wanted to make more of their online camaraderie. I was fortunate enough to fall into this group the second year in and have been making it out every November that I can. This shot was taken last year from outside Ryan Campground. A climber can be seen making his way up a route called The Northwest Corner of Headstone Rock. This is a fun little sports climb that challenges ones aversion to exposure more than climbing skill.
